How to Turn On Android TV Box Without Remote: 4 Easy Methods to Try

If you own an Android TV box, you might have encountered the problem of turning it on without the remote control. The remote control is an essential component that lets you access all the functions of your device. But if you happen to lose it or your remote control suddenly stops working, then what should you do? Dont worry; we have got you covered. In this article, we will show you 4 easy methods to turn on your Android TV box without a remote.

Method 1: Use the Power Button on the TV Box

The most basic and easiest way to turn on your Android TV box without a remote is to use the power button located on your device. Look for the power button, which is usually located on the top or sides of the TV box. Press and hold the button for a few seconds, and your device should turn on.

Method 2: Use a USB Mouse or Keyboard

If your Android TV box allows the connection of a USB mouse or keyboard, then this is another option to consider. Plug in the USB mouse or keyboard to the device, and then use the mouse or keyboard to navigate the interface and turn on the device. Press the power button on the interface, and your TV box should turn on.

Method 3: Use a Mobile App

There are several mobile apps available on Google Play Store that can help you control your Android TV box. These apps connect your mobile device to your TV box and provide a virtual remote control on your phone. You can use the app to turn on your TV box, as well as to navigate the interface.

Method 4: Use HDMI-CEC

If your TV box and TV support HDMI-CEC, then you can use this feature to control your device. HDMI-CEC allows you to control multiple HDMI-enabled devices with one remote control. Check if your TV has this feature enabled, and then use the TV remote to turn on the TV box.

How to Turn On Android TV Box Without Remote

Android TV box is a compact and efficient device that connects to your television, allowing you to stream content from various internet sources. However, for those times when you cant find your remote control, turning on the Android TV box can be a challenging task. Fortunately, there are several other ways to turn on your device without using the remote control. Below are some of them.

1. Use the TVs CEC Function

Many television sets come with a Consumer Electronics Control (CEC) feature that lets you use your TVs remote to control other compatible devices connected to it. If your Android TV box is CEC-enabled, you can turn it on by pressing the power button on your TVs remote control.

However, this feature may not work on all TVs, so you should check your TVs user manual to see if it supports CEC. Additionally, youll need to enable the CEC function on both your TV and Android TV box for this method to work.

2. Use Google Home App

If you have a Google Home app installed on your smartphone or tablet, you can use it to turn on your Android TV box. First, ensure that both your Android TV box and device are connected to the same Wi-Fi network. Then, open the Google Home app, tap the menu icon on the top left corner, and navigate to "Devices."

Select your Android TV box from the list of devices, and tap "Power." This action turns on your Android TV box without the need for a remote control.

3. Unplug and Re-plug the Power Cord

If all the above methods fail, you can try plugging and unplugging your Android TV boxs power cord. While it may sound simple, this method has been proven to work on several occasions.

Start by disconnecting the power cord and waiting for about 10 seconds before plugging it back in. This action causes the device to turn on automatically once its connected to the power source.
